Ashland’s stock rise may have more to do with this event, versus earnings By Investing.com

Ashland Global Holdings (ASH) shares rose 5.91% to $72.03 on Jul 28, driven by two simultaneous events. The company reported Q3 FY26 revenue of $497M (+7% YoY) and adjusted EPS of $1.02, beating estimates. It also confirmed a cooperation agreement with activist Ancora, adding independent directors and a capital allocation committee, with analysts citing activism in raised price targets of $77-$78.

Ashland jumps on sale exploration report after takeover interest

Ashland Global Holdings (NYSE:ASH) rose about 5.5% after Bloomberg reported the chemical maker is exploring a potential sale amid takeover interest. Bloomberg said Ashland is working with Citigroup and Lazard and has had contact from firms including Advent, Apollo, and Carlyle, with Standard Industries also interested. Deliberations are ongoing and no deal is assured.

Ashland nears settlement with activist Ancora Holdings - Bloomberg By Investing.com

Bloomberg reports Ashland Inc. is nearing a settlement with activist Ancora Holdings Group that would add two directors to Ashland’s board and create a capital allocation committee, according to people familiar with the matter. The details are not public and could be announced as soon as today. Ancora disclosed a stake in Ashland in June and urged a sale; Cruiser Capital also launched a campaign.
